Apply Now: GSGA Student Awards!
Spring applications are open for the GSGA Student Awards! The GSGA Student Awards support professional development, conference attendance, and community service. Fall semester applications will be accepted through April 1, 2025, so be sure to submit your application before the deadline!
Visit this link for more information and details on awards and applications.
2024-2025 GSGA Award Budget Form: this is the budget form that has to be filled out with the proposed itemizing estimated costs for relevant expenses and should be submitted and uploaded within the application.
There are three awards you can apply for:
1.Publication and Dissemination Award
To support CUNY SPH students in their academic and professional growth, the GSGA will provide monetary awards up to $750.00 per award to matriculated students and those who have graduated within the last 12 months that publish peer-reviewed manuscripts or disseminate findings via multimedia outlets related to public health.
Click here for more information.
2.Community Service Award
To recognize service to the community by currently registered CUNY SPH students while in pursuit of their degree, the GSGA will provide monetary awards (funded through collected student activity fees). The value of each award is up to $750.00
Click here for more information.
3.Student Success Award
To support current CUNY SPH students while in pursuit of their graduate degree, the GSGA will provide monetary awards (funded through collected student activity fees) to students to support costs for professional growth opportunities. Students may apply for up to $1,000.00.

Apply Now: Ferguson RISE Fellowship
Are you a current CUNY SPH grad student or recent postgrad from a historically marginalized community interested in infectious disease research? The Dr. James A. Ferguson RISE Fellowship offers full-time summer (Memorial Day to early August), 6-month part-time or full-time, and 12-month full-time public health research experiences at the CDC, local health departments, or academic institutions (including CUNY SPH).
Fellows focus on infectious diseases, health equity, epidemiology, data science, and more. Fellows will support public health research and professional development in infectious diseases and health disparities, focusing on increasing knowledge and interest in public health research careers.
Application Deadlines:
6-month fellowship: Dec 2, 2024
Summer & 12-month fellowships: Jan 31, 2025
